Which item is described as the type of feed for the M2HB?

Explanation:
The item described is a belt-fed ammunition system. The M2HB is designed to be fed from a linked belt, not from magazines or drums, which allows for continuous, sustained fire. A 100-round belt is the standard, practical belt size used for this weapon, making it the best description of how the M2HB is fed. magazines or drum feeds (like a 50-round drum or a 30-round magazine) don’t match the gun’s feed mechanism, so they wouldn’t describe how the M2HB actually receives rounds.
